Classic Eyelash Extensions: Choosing the Perfect Fit
Embarking on your eyelash extension journey? It's exciting to transform your lash look! When selecting between classic and volume lashes, consider your desired intensity. Classic extensions use one lash for each natural lash, creating a subtle definition. Volume lashes, on the other hand, use multiple lashes to create a fuller, more dramatic impact. If you prefer a subtle enhancement, classic extensions are perfect. For those seeking a bold, glamorous change, volume lashes are your go-to choice.

Types of Eyelash Extensions: Finding Your Dream Look
Ready to take your lash game to the next level? Eyelash extensions offer a variety of options to achieve your dream look. Whether you're after subtle volume, fierce length, or a modern style, there's a perfect set for you.
Let's explore some popular categories of eyelash extensions:
* **Classic lashes:** These extensions use a single lash extension per natural lash, creating a subtle enhancement.
* **Volume lashes:** For dramatic volume, multiple lash extensions are attached to each own natural lash.
* **Hybrid lashes:** This combination of classic and volume lashes offers a balance between subtlety and drama.
Don't forget to consider the curl of your extensions – options like J, B, C curl can drastically change the look.
With so many choices available, finding the perfect eyelash extensions for you is a breeze. Talk to a professional lash technician to discuss your preferences and goals. They'll help you create a stunning look that enhances your features perfectly.
